@Anonymous wrote:

... try to add materials to model to change the colour ...


One thing to be aware of is that Materials (properties like mass...) are different than Appearances (colors).

I can make a block of wood have the appearance (but not the properties) of Gold, but you probably wouldn't pay me the price of gold for the block of wood.

I can make a block of gold have the appearance of wood (but not the properties), you would probably be happy to pay me the price of wood for the gold block.
